Abstract

The method involves superimposing a glue on an air permeable mounting plate (1) e.g. medium density fiberboard, and applying veneer pre-cut parts (2) on the plate. A negative pressure is produced at a side opposite to the pre-cut parts by openings (4) that are present at a top side of a coating station for absorption and fixing of the pre-cut parts. The pre-cut parts with its edges are put together on a surface of the plate. Independent claims are also included for the following: (A) a furniture plate with a mounting plate and veneer pre-cut parts (B) a device for manufacturing a furniture plate.

Claims (10)

  1. Method for the manufacture of furniture panels involving the following stages:
    - Application of adhesive to a carrier panel (1);
    - Laying sheets of veneer (2) on the adhesive-coated carrier panel (1), or the adhesive-coated carrier panel on sheets of veneer (2);
    characterized by the steps:
    - generation of a negative pressure on the sheets of veneer (2) or the carrier panel (1) for the purpose of the attachment by suction and securing of the sheets of veneer (2) to the carrier panel (1), and
    - compression of the carrier panel (1) with the sheets of veneer (2).
  2. Method according to Claim 1, characterized in that the adhesive-coated carrier panel (1) or the sheets of veneer (2) is/are laid on a table, on the top surface (3) of which a plurality of openings (4) is provided for the generation of the negative pressure.
  3. Method according to Claims 1 or 2, characterized in that the sheets of veneer (2) are laid on the adhesive-coated surface of the carrier panel (1) with their edges flush with one another.
  4. Method according to one of Claims 1 to 3, characterized in that an MDF panel or a particle board is used as the carrier panel (1).
  5. Method according to one of Claims 1 to 4, characterized in that the carrier panel (1) is air-permeable and exhibits a thickness of between 3 and 25 mm, and preferably 5 to 20 mm.
  6. Method according to one of Claims 1 to 5, characterized in that the carrier panel (1) is coated with adhesive on both sides and is covered with sheets of veneer (2).
  7. Method according to one of Claims 1 to 6, characterized in that strip-shaped sheets of veneer (11, 31) are laid in position, the width of which is smaller than 50 mm, and preferably smaller than 40 mm.
